Steel Eating ( Rifle rounds vs steel)


Shooting the AR-15, the M1-A, & the SKS at thick steel: a close-up perspective. Shots were taken from behind a large tree at approximately 40 yards. Guns used: Russian SKS, Colt AR-15 A2, Springfield M1-A Disclaimer: Lots of discussion about 5.56 vs .223 and 7.62 X 51 vs .308. The guns you see me use in this video will fire either one safely, so no issue for me. Never HAS been. Be sure you do your research and shoot what your guns will handle. I have to explain this about once a week, it seems; most people have limited experience shooting 7.62X39 rounds at steel, which is understandable, of course. :-) I've shot both hollow point and FMJ 7.62X39 at soft steel for many years. The FMJ and the hollow point have pretty much the exact same effect on it. HPs are not exactly designed to expand in steel. :-) See my folllow-up video that I finally did all these months later: www.youtube.com

History of M1 Carbine


David Marshal Williams was born in Cumberland County, North Carolina eldest of seven children. As a young boy, he worked on his family's farm. He dropped out of school after eighth grade and began work in a blacksmith shop, enjoyed a short stint in Navy, but was discharged because he was underage. After returning from the Navy, he spent a semester at Blackstone Military Academy before being expelled. In 1918, he married Margaret Cooke and they later had one child, David Marshall, Jr. Williams worked for Atlantic Coast Line Railroad, but on the side he had an illegal distillery near Godwin, North Carolina. During a raid on this still on July 22, 1921, a deputy sheriff Alfred Jackson Pate was shot and killed, and Williams was charged with first degree murder. The trial ended in a hung jury, but Williams decided to plead guilty to a lesser charge of second degree murder. He was given a 20-30 year sentence. While serving time at the Caledonia State Prison Farm in Halifax County, North Carolina the superintendent, HT Peoples, noted his mechanical aptitude and allowed him access to the prison's machine shop where he demonstrated a genius for fashioning replacement parts for the guards' firearms from pieces of scrap automobile parts. In prison, he would save paper and pencils and stay up late at night drawing plans for various firearms. Combative Edge M1: "Thin, Fast Fighter" by Nutnfancy


The Combative Edge M1 is a big blade. But it's a fighting blade and maybe that's what the loadout calls for. From the outset, this new blade is designed as a folding fighting knife, pure and simple. If you haven't heard of Combative Edge blades, don't worry. That's my job and this video will change that. Designer Rob Walker's M1 gets many things right which is impressive for a first design. It's fast in deployment and you can choose either the well-designed thumbstuds or the flipper. The phoshor bronze bushings and excellent overall balance of the blade provide this amazing speed for such a large slab of steel. Lockup is solid and wiggle-free in this titanium framelock. In some tough cardboard testing some loosening was noted but it tightened up again with a little work on the pivot screw and Lock-Tite. The blade shape is organic and cuts aggressively. Tip is strong and the N690 steel holds an edge well, has excellent rust resistance, and sharpens easy enough. Very VG10-like. For me this M1's blade is a bit thick at about 4mm. That probably accounts for the knife's 5.3 ounce carry weight. But for a blade of this size, it's still reasonable. The blackened loop pocket clip reverses for tip-up or down (not ambi however) and carries deeply. The CE M1 also has some impressive ergos: deep finger choil and an effective guard and whadda' know, the finger ridges (jimping) on the knife in all sections are outstanding.
